Whimsical Designs is starting a book of the month challenge!

...A book club?! For crafters?! Are we going to be reading craft books? Nope! We're going to be reading regular novels and creating projects inspired by what we read!

For those of you who love to read and craft, this monthly challenge is for you! 



Here's how it will work:
- The first Monday of each month we will announce the book we are reading for the month and what the prize is for that challenge

- You will have the entire month to read the selected book

- You will then create any type of crafty project inspired by the book or a certain part of the book

This month, we are reading "Alex Cross, Run" by James Patterson:


On July 1st, the new book we will be reading for July will be announced, DT inspiration projects will be posted, and a linky will be included so you can upload your book project for "Alex Cross, Run." You'll have two weeks to link up your project, and then a random winner will be chosen.

This month our prize is $50 worth of Copic markers! The winner chooses the colors.
